Predict the Scottish Premiership, live
The Scottish Premiership is Scotland's top flight and the home of the Old Firm, the fixture between Celtic and Rangers that shapes the title race almost every season. Beyond Glasgow, Aberdeen, Hearts and Hibernian carry big travelling supports and long histories, and the smaller grounds produce an atmosphere that television rarely does justice. The league splits into a top half and a bottom half late in the campaign, which turns the final rounds into two separate scraps - one for Europe, one for survival.
Scottish league football dates back to 1890 and the modern Premiership carries all of that weight, from Celtic's 1967 European Cup win to the derby that has run since the nineteenth century. The post-split format is the league's defining quirk: once the fixtures are divided, every remaining match is played against a direct rival, so the run-in is unusually intense at both ends of the table. Celtic and Rangers dominate the honours, but Aberdeen, Hearts and Hibernian have all had spells of pushing them, and cup upsets are part of the Scottish calendar.

What is the Scottish Premiership split?
Late in the season the league divides into a top half and a bottom half, and clubs then play only within their own section for the remaining fixtures. Nobody can move between the halves after the split, so the top group is a straight fight for the title and European places while the bottom group is about avoiding relegation. For predictions it means the run-in is packed with matches between sides with something real riding on the result.

When are Scottish Premiership matches played?
Most Premiership fixtures land on Saturday afternoon, with selected matches moved to Saturday lunchtime, Sunday or a midweek evening for television. Times are set in UK time, and CalledItMate shows every fixture in your own time zone. Scotland also plays through the winter with a short break, so there are live matches to predict at points in the calendar when several other European leagues are shut down.
